The video explores two theories about time: Presentism, where only the present is real, and Eternalism, where past, present, and future are equally real. Eternalism supports the concept of a Block Universe, allowing discussions on time travel. Presentism dismisses time travel as only the present exists. The video highlights a conflict between neuroscience, which perceives time as flowing, and physics, which often supports the Block Universe model. It questions whether our perception of time flow is an objective reality or an illusion, suggesting a need for dialogue between physics and neuroscience.
